- 积分
- 93
- 下载分
- 分
- 威望
- 点
- 原创币
- 点
- 下载
- 次
- 上传
- 次
- 注册时间
- 2020-10-15
- 精华
|
马上注册,获取阅读精华内容及下载权限
您需要 登录 才可以下载或查看,没有帐号?注册
x
本帖最后由 zhaoyueming 于 2024-2-18 20:34 编辑
大家都希望安卓手机系统运行速度更快 卡顿更减少 现在有个更好的方法可以 这是我突然发现的
那就是 现在的安卓手机都是大核心加小核心的cpu 这就是关键所在 简单说就是 把安卓手机所有的小核心全部关闭 只打开大核心 安卓手机系统运行速度最快 卡顿最少 根本原因就在于 小核心作为首先使用导致大核心却不是首先使用的 安卓手机当然达不到最好的cpu速度
所以
1保证你的安卓手机一定root 因为没有root无法关闭安卓手机所有的小核心
2
下载 镧系统工具箱 随便搜一下就找到了
镧系统工具箱目的就是可以关闭安卓手机尤其是高通cpu的安卓手机的所有小核心 这个软件必要的
3
下载了镧系统工具箱还不行 还需要下载一个桌面软件 这个桌面软件就是
adw桌面启动器
这个桌面软件就是把镧系统工具箱隐藏的开启关闭cpu核心的单独的功能界面显示出来的必备桌面软件 不然镧系统工具箱自带的正常界面无法关闭cpu小核心的
4
现在我演示一下如何关闭安卓手机所有的cpu小核心
首先安装 镧系统工具箱
安装后一定正常启动一次镧系统工具箱 不然隐藏的开启关闭cpu界面会打不开
再安装adw桌面启动器
然后启动一次adw桌面 不需要把adw桌面作为默认桌面的
然后在adw桌面长按屏幕打开adw桌面的菜单
依次按图片操作
5
图片操作步奏是
添加 自定义快捷方式 选择您的活动 活动
再找到 镧系统工具箱并展开 最后选择 处理器锁核心 添加到adw桌面就行了
注意 如果高通专属模式无法开启关闭cpu核心 取消高通专属模式对号再开启关闭cpu核心
只需要打开2个cpu大核心系统就能流畅运行 不需要把大核心全部打开 这样手机可以使用更长时间
cpu大核心基本都是cpu数字越大的 不是cpu数字最小的
把大核心打开再关闭所有小核心 才能关闭cpu0
也就是把所有cpu小核心全部关闭 包括cpu0都关闭 只打开大核心的cpu 就行了
你会发现安卓手机运行速度非常快 卡顿非常减少 而且打开各个界面非常快速
看看是否关闭了所有的cpu小核心有个方法 那就是用es文件管理器打开安卓手机根目录的/sys/devices/system/cpu/online这个文件 文件里面显示的数字代表哪个cpu核心开启 总之 所有的小核心代表的数字全部不出现就是正确的
比如出现6-7代表只打开cpu6和cpu7这两个大核心
如果大核心只有两个 小核心却有四个的cpu 那么需要先测试到底大核心速度快还是4个小核心速度快
如果大核心和小核心数量不一样 需要先测试到底大核心速度快还是小核心速度快
但是基本大核心是最快的 即使数量比小核心少
如果大核心和小核心数量一样 必然是大核心速度最快最好
| 一定关闭安卓手机所有的cpu小核心 小核心才是系统缓慢卡顿的根本原因
重点说明 安卓手机所有cpu核心打开反而才是系统缓慢卡顿原因 因为会默认小核心先使用 大核心不使用空载或者小核心负载过大才使用 这就使得系统默认都是小核心发挥作用 大核心没有发挥作用 所以 把所有小核心关闭后 大核心就会自然发挥作用 从而让系统最流畅
手机的大核心和小核心不能同时发挥作用 所以会根据情况选择 日常就是小核心发挥作用 游戏大核心发挥作用 所以 关闭所有的小核心就是让cpu发挥最好
当然也可以用命令方式关闭cpu所有小核心 下面的命令是关闭4个小核心 开启4个大核心 一般手机都是八核心
命令方式需要下载终端模拟器 且保证手机root
chmod 0777 /sys/devices/system/cpu/cpu7/online
echo '1' > /sys/devices/system/cpu/cpu7/online
chmod 0777 /sys/devices/system/cpu/cpu6/online
echo '1' > /sys/devices/system/cpu/cpu6/online
chmod 0777 /sys/devices/system/cpu/cpu5/online
echo '1' > /sys/devices/system/cpu/cpu5/online
chmod 0777 /sys/devices/system/cpu/cpu4/online
echo '1' > /sys/devices/system/cpu/cpu4/online
chmod 0777 /sys/devices/system/cpu/cpu3/online
echo '0' > /sys/devices/system/cpu/cpu3/online
chmod 0777 /sys/devices/system/cpu/cpu2/online
echo '0' > /sys/devices/system/cpu/cpu2/online
chmod 0777 /sys/devices/system/cpu/cpu1/online
echo '0' > /sys/devices/system/cpu/cpu1/online
chmod 0777 /sys/devices/system/cpu/cpu0/online
echo '0' > /sys/devices/system/cpu/cpu0/online
注意 不同手机小核心代表的数字不一样 所以根据不同的cpu关闭所有小核心
注意 安卓系统是有温控的 需要把温控文件删除才能让cpu大核心一直使用 不然电池过低温度过高都会让大核心关闭 小核心打开
删除安卓系统温控文件用es文件管理器打开根目录的/system文件夹
然后搜索 thermal 把出现的所有带thermal字词的文件都删除 注意.so后缀的文件不要删除 不然有些安卓系统无法正常启动
删除温控文件后需重启手机让温控消失
还可以使用 镧系统工具箱 自带的温控删除功能 而且只是把温控文件权限全部取消对号无法读取使用 而不是删除温控文件 这样可以恢复温控
打开镧系统工具箱的处理器高级配置就可以取消温控
然后重启手机让温控消失
额外说明 让手机可以使用更长时间 还需要把gpu的频率降的最低 gpu基本用不到的
打开镧系统工具箱的处理器基本配置更改gpu最高频率为最低即可
额外说明 把低内存阀值oom各个数值设置最大也可以让系统速度变快
安装kernel adiutor然后找到 低内存清理器 把各个数值变的最大就行
当然也可以使用命令方式 需要安装终端模拟器
chmod 0777 /sys/module/lowmemorykiller/parameters/minfree
chown root /sys/module/lowmemorykiller/parameters/minfree
echo '262144,262144,262144,262144,262144,262144' > /sys/module/lowmemorykiller/parameters/minfree
现在手机处理内存都非常大 根本不用担心低内存阀值太大自动结束程序
补充内容 (2024-10-14 03:44):
只使用cpu大核心不使用小核心依然不能发挥cpu最快速度 因为cpu运行模式还需调整 最好把cpu调整为performance最高性能模式 cpu永远最高频率运行 但耗电发热大一些 可以只开一个cpu大核心关闭其他核心解决耗电发热
补充内容 (2024-10-14 03:53):
推荐使用interactive模式 但想达到最快速度 还需把/sys/devices/system/cpu/cpufreq/interactive/timer_rate这个文件数值设置最低 也就是10000 让cpu以最快的速度应答 timer_rate值越小cpu反应应答越快越不会迟钝
补充内容 (2024-10-14 05:56):
如果timer_rate数值可以设置为0就设置为0 0才是最快的速度 有些安卓系统不允许timer_rate文件数值设置为0 只能最低为10000
注意timer_rate这个文件根据cpu不同有不同的路径 但都是timer_rate这个文件 |
|